Description

The metering pumps D series are driven by an electric motor, the dosage takes place thanks to a NBR/PTFE (material in contact with the liquid) diaphragm. The D series pumps make their robustness and reliability their main characteristic. • Valves: Single ball with SS316L pump head - Double balls with PVC pump head • Frequency: 60, 103 and 120 strokes/min at 50Hz - 72 and 122 strokes/min at 60Hz • Diaphragm in NBR/PTFE - PTFE material in contact with the chemical • Die-cast aluminum housing protected by epoxy/antiacid paint • Pump Head: PVC, SS316L or PVDF • Balls: ceramic or SS316L • Ball seats FPM, EPDM or NBR • Valves seats in PVC or PVDF • IP55 protection degree • Insulation class: F On request D pumps series can be equipped with: Motorizations: • Without motor • UL/CSA motor certification • Single-phase motor • Self-ventilated motor • ATEX motor • Tropicalized motor Hydraulic: • NPT hydraulic connections • Larger dimensions valves Regulation and control by an external signal: • Electric actuator (automatic adjustment of piston “run” by a 4-20mA signal) • Inverter (automatic adjustment od motor speed by a 4-20mA signal)
